    TaskFlow — Team Task Management Platform

    A multi-tenant team task platform built to work the way real teams do: teams with role-based memberships, projects scoped to a team, and tasks with categories, comments and activity history.

    Backend is Spring Boot with JWT authentication, a validation-first service layer, activity logging for audit trails, and paginated, filtered task queries. Front end is React and TypeScript with protected routing, typed API services and reusable form components. Linting, unit tests and a GitHub Actions CI pipeline on both sides.

    Built with: Java, Spring Boot, MySQL, React, TypeScript, Tailwind, GitHub Actions

    Pawsonality Gear — E-commerce Application

    A working e-commerce application with real payment processing and live inventory.

    Built Stripe Checkout for payments, variant-based inventory (size and colour combinations tracked separately), and a persistent cart. The Firestore database uses transactional stock updates so inventory stays accurate when several people are buying at once — the problem most small store builds get wrong.

    React front end deployed to GitHub Pages, Express and Stripe backend on Render.

    Jobs Platform — Full-Stack Web Application with Natural-Language Interface

    A full-stack job management platform I designed, built, deployed and run in production.

    What it does: users manage job applications through a filterable, sortable dashboard, with secure accounts and structured workflows behind it.

    How it’s built: a Spring Boot REST API with layered architecture, JWT authentication in HTTP-only cookies and CSRF protection. React and TypeScript on the front end, with filtering, sorting, pagination and proper error handling. MySQL for persistence.

    The interesting part: a custom MCP-based routing layer that takes plain-English requests and turns them into confirmed actions against the API — with a confirmation step before anything is executed.

    Deployment: Spring Boot API on AWS Elastic Beanstalk, MySQL on RDS, React front end on Amplify, custom domain through Route 53. It’s live and I operate it.
